Here’s how I made it –

The base is Crisp Cantaloupe Cardstock – 4 1/4 x 11.  It seems I am using that color more and more!

The next layer is Whisper White 4 x 5 1/4 – and has the Dictionary stamp inked very lightly and stamped over the entire piece. 

I used Crisp Canteloupe Ink and stamped the Beautiful Baroque stamp on the Whisper White layer.
Before I attached this to my card front, I added a piece of Baked Brown
Sugar Trim to the  back of the piece at the bottom. It just seems to
soften it all a bit. 

For the banners, I used Sassy Salutations Stamp Set – it’s become my “go to” stamp set for bold greetings.  Love it!   I also made a banner with some of the gold vellum.

I wrapped the banners with Gold Bakers Twine and attached the entire piece to the card front with a dimensional.
